将多个图像附加到分类术语

时间:2009-11-26 21:52:51

标签: drupal drupal-6 drupal-modules

我已经安装了“Taxonomy Image”模块。 但我找不到将多个图像附加到一个分类术语的方法

我的drupal版本是6

3 个答案:

答案 0 :(得分:4)

作为Henrik所回答的一个附注,另一种实现所需内容而无需编写单行的方法可能是:

  1. 为分类的每个术语创建“图像节点”。
  2. 将每个图像节点关联到分类法的正确术语(这里有趣的地方:您可以为每个术语创建多个图像节点,也可以将不同的术语用于相同的图像节点)。
  3. 创建一个wiew,其中包含分类术语/术语作为参数,并显示标记有该术语的所有图像节点。
  4. 如果你已经知道views module,你可能会意识到这是多么容易。如果你是Drupal的新手并且还不知道,那么我recommend你会与CCK一起密切关注它:它们很大,需要一些时间来“grokked”(但是,尽管如此!但是你花在研究它们上的每一秒都是值得的!

    使用视图还可以为您提供更多的灵活性,因为您可以轻松地在表格,列表,网格,添加或删除关联字段中设置主题,甚至可以放置主题额外的过滤器或在单独的块中将它们暴露给用户......

    HTH!

答案 1 :(得分:3)

据我所知,该模块没有提供将多个图像附加到一个术语的选项。来自features list on the project page

  
      
  • 允许一对一的术语/图像关系。
  •   
  • 允许多对一的术语到图像关系。
  •   

因此,一个术语可以完全在图像上,或者多个术语可以具有相同的图像(对于父术语图像的“继承”),但没有“每个术语多个图像”选项。

我还没有深入研究模块代码,看看是否有一种简单的方法可以改变它。到目前为止,there seems to be no request for this feature也是。

答案 2 :(得分:0)

最简单的方法是先安装以下模块:

启用两个模块后。转到管理 >> 结构 >> 视图并编辑管理:文件视图。添加所需的分类字段。

返回管理 >> 内容 >> 文件,您现在将看到操作,选择更改值和您希望具有相同分类术语的所需图像。单击执行 >> 您的分类法字段。选择一个或多个术语,然后单击下一步。就是这样。